.site-footer{background:var(--primary-very-low);font-size:.875rem;color:var(--primary-medium)}.site-footer__inner{width:100%;max-width:80rem;margin:0 auto;padding:3rem 1rem;display:flex;flex-direction:column;gap:1.75rem;box-sizing:border-box}.site-footer__grid{display:grid;grid-template-columns:repeat(2, 1fr);gap:2rem}.site-footer__brand{grid-column:span 2;text-align:center}.site-footer__logo img{height:2.667em;padding:.5rem 0;display:inline-block}.site-footer__social{list-style:none;margin:1.25rem 0 0;padding:0;display:flex;gap:1.25rem;justify-content:center}.site-footer__social svg{width:1rem;height:1rem;fill:var(--primary-medium);transition:fill .15s ease}.site-footer__social a:hover svg{fill:#0284c7}.site-footer__google{display:inline-flex;align-items:center;gap:.375rem;height:2.25rem;margin-top:1.25rem;padding:0 .75rem;border-radius:9999px;background:var(--secondary);border:1px solid var(--primary-low);font-size:.875rem;font-weight:500;color:var(--primary-high);transition:background .15s ease}.site-footer__google:hover{background:var(--primary-low)}.site-footer__google svg{width:1rem;height:1rem}.site-footer__col h3{font-weight:600;color:var(--primary);margin:0 0 1rem}.site-footer__col ul{list-style:none;margin:0;padding:0;display:flex;flex-direction:column;gap:.5rem}.site-footer__col a{color:var(--primary-high);transition:color .15s ease}.site-footer__col a:hover{color:#0284c7}.site-footer__divider{width:100%;height:1px;background:var(--primary-low)}.site-footer__bottom{display:flex;flex-direction:column-reverse;align-items:center;gap:1rem}.site-footer__legal{color:var(--primary-medium);text-align:center}.site-footer__copy{margin-top:1.5rem}.site-footer__links{display:flex;gap:1.25rem}.site-footer__links a{font-size:.875rem;color:var(--primary-medium);transition:color .15s ease}.site-footer__links a:hover{color:#0284c7}@media(min-width: 768px){.site-footer__inner{padding:3rem 2rem}.site-footer__grid{grid-template-columns:repeat(8, 1fr)}.site-footer__brand{grid-column:span 4;text-align:left}.site-footer__social{justify-content:flex-start}.site-footer__social svg{width:1.5rem;height:1.5rem}.site-footer__col{grid-column:span 2}.site-footer__bottom{flex-direction:row;justify-content:space-between}.site-footer__legal{text-align:left}}
/*# sourceMappingURL=common_theme_23_68967a0586b1c6dc2f5b7e7606bad590c265d46c.css.map?__ws=forum.betaprofiles.com */
